Two Vertical buildings 91 metres apart are136 metres and 192 metres high respectively. Find the angle of elevation form the top of the shorter building o the top of the taller building to the nearest degree
1 answer:
Answer:
≈ 32°
Step-by-step explanation:
Distance between buildings= 91 m
Elevation difference= 192 m- 136 m= 56 m
Right triangle ΔABC is formed by connecting 3 points, see attached
∠C is one to be calculated
tan C=AB/AC= 56/91
tan C= 0.62
∠C ≈ 32°
